The hexadecimal color code #73495F corresponds to the code RGB( 115, 73, 95 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 0,45 level), green (at 0,29 level) and blue (at 0,37 level). Its brightness is 36% and its saturation is 22%. It is composed of red at 40%, green at 25% and blue at 33%.
